Zope与MySQL整合应用技术分析

版权申诉
0 下载量 188 浏览量 更新于2024-10-26 收藏 116KB RAR 举报
资源摘要信息:"Zope与MySQL的集成与应用" 标题中所提到的"Zope_and_MySQL.rar"指的是一个关于Zope内容管理系统和MySQL数据库集成的资源包。Zope(Python Object Publishing Environment)是一个开源的Web应用服务器和内容管理系统,它使用Python编程语言进行开发。在互联网早期,Zope是一个非常流行的系统,尤其在企业环境中,它支持多种功能,包括但不限于内容发布、工作流、内容管理、协作和身份验证等。Zope的这些功能使其成为一个强大的平台,可以在其之上构建复杂的Web应用程序。 描述中提到的"zope and mysql of aj_hall_com"可能指向一个特定的教程、手册或案例研究,该文档可能包含了AJ Hall公司关于如何将Zope与MySQL数据库集成的详细信息和实践案例。MySQL是一种流行的开源关系型数据库管理系统,以其高性能、高可靠性和易用性而闻名。在许多Web应用中,MySQL作为后端数据库,用于存储和管理数据,而Zope可以作为前端应用服务器,通过某种编程接口与MySQL进行数据交互。 文件名列表中只有一个文件,即"Zope_and_MySQL.pdf",这表明这个压缩包内可能只包含一个PDF文档。PDF格式适合存储文档内容,尤其是在需要保持排版格式、图片和字体不变的情况下。PDF格式的文件通常用于分享用户手册、技术白皮书、教学文档等。 在关于Zope与MySQL集成的具体知识点方面,可能包含以下内容: 1. Zope与MySQL集成的基本概念:介绍Zope和MySQL的简介,以及它们各自的特点和优势,特别是它们为什么会被一起使用以及这样做的好处。 2. 安装和配置:详细介绍如何在系统中安装Zope和MySQL,以及如何进行初始配置以便它们可以相互通信。这可能包括数据库的创建、用户权限的设置、连接参数的配置等。 3. 数据库访问:说明如何从Zope应用中访问MySQL数据库。这可能包括使用Python和Zope的特定接口或API(例如,Zope Database API,即ZODB,或者DB-API)来执行SQL查询和管理数据。 4. 编程实践:提供一些编程示例或模式,展示如何在Zope应用中有效地使用MySQL数据库。这可能包括创建、读取、更新和删除(CRUD)操作的实现,以及高级功能如事务管理和索引优化。 5. 性能优化:讨论关于提高Zope和MySQL集成应用性能的策略。这可能包括查询优化、缓存使用、连接池管理等。 6. 安全考虑:介绍在集成Zope与MySQL时需要注意的安全问题,例如防止SQL注入攻击、数据加密、用户权限管理等。 7. 故障排除:提供关于如何诊断和解决在集成Zope与MySQL过程中可能遇到的常见问题的指南。 8. 案例研究:如果文件中包含实际的案例研究,可能会提供一些公司如何使用Zope和MySQL集成来解决特定问题的例子,提供实际应用中的经验和教训。 这些知识点提供了从基本概念到高级应用,再到实际问题解决的全面指导,对于希望了解或实践Zope与MySQL集成的用户来说,是极有价值的学习资源。由于描述中提到了特定的"aj_hall_com",这可能意味着文档是针对该公司的特定需求和架构而定制的。